What are two main components of a virus

Biology
1 answer:
andrew11 [14]4 years ago
6 0
Nucleic Acid Genome and Protein Capsid forming Nucleocapsid.

All sensory information, with the exception of olfaction, must pass though the ________ as it travels to the cerebral cortex. ce
Whitepunk [10]

Answer:

\huge\boxed{\sf Thalamus}

Explanation:

All the sensory information through sensory neurons must pass through the thalamus.

<u>Thalamus:</u>

  • connects cerebral cortex and midbrain.
  • collects information from the midbrain and passes it to the cerebral cortex.
  • is involved in more functions such as; detects sensations of visual, auditory, and gustatory systems.
  • is concerned with memory, emotions.
